YOUNGSTERS with a passion for football have put their dribbling skills to the test this summer, at specialist soccer camps.
Colin Henwood, 58, who is chairman of Benfleet Villa Football Club, has organised the camps every other week this summer.
Held at the John Barrows Recreation Ground off Rectory Road, in Hadleigh, the football camps are for five to 14-year-old girls and boys.
They run weekdays, Tuesday to Friday, from 10am to 3pm and are led by qualified coaches.
Mr Henwood said: "The children who come to our groups get a lot of enjoyment out of playing with youngsters their own age and of different abilities.
"They also learn a lot from the coaches and get satisifaction out of knowing their skills have developed over the course of the week.
"We also run training sessions at the Rectory Road ground every Saturday throughout the year.
"The only time we don't play is if there's 6ft of snow, which is rare in Essex."
Mr Henwood added the next soccer camp will be held from Tuesday, August 28, to Friday, August 31.
The cost for the four-day course is £50, but this varies according to the number of days a child attends.
